logo

Output 60477b1451a04fb2317cb570af802f9d1e8b67c37e4ff562068af55cf7cf7655:3

value
17070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 497ed58514760d013b241f0d0f40a3d861292daf OP_EQUAL
address
38PdC8dwwTG4ttUatq9SHaYCTdZb5a5yAD
transaction
60477b1451a04fb2317cb570af802f9d1e8b67c37e4ff562068af55cf7cf7655